Cybersecurity is one of the fastest-growing industries in the world. It is highly important for modern business. It is important for the consumer as well. Cybersecurity refers to the technology designed to protect us from electronic crimes.

Today the fastest-growing segment of the criminal underworld is online. The internet facilitates tons of transactions every day, but not all of those transactions are legitimate.

You would be surprised at the amount of fraudulent activity that occurs on the Internet. It is especially prevalent on websites without good cybersecurity.

Thoughts on the Importance of Cybersecurity Assessment 

Cybersecurity Assessment is a highly important industry for numerous businesses. A Cybersecurity Assessment will help you know for sure. No matter how much you’ve invested in your cybersecurity, you can’t just assume it’s effective enough to protect you against cybercriminals. A key best practice for cybersecurity is to regularly test your measures to make sure they hold up in the event of an attack, and to identify any unseen vulnerabilities that are putting you at risk. Consumers also rely on cybersecurity to protect them from potential fraudsters.
